C# Class Amoeba.TransfarLimitManager

Inheritance: Library.StateManagerBase, Library.Configuration.ISettings, IThisLock
Datei anzeigen Open project: Alliance-Network/Amoeba

Public Properties

Property Type Description
_startEvent EventHandler
_stopEvent EventHandler

Public Methods

Method Description
Load ( string directoryPath ) : void
Reset ( ) : void
Save ( string directoryPath ) : void
Start ( ) : void
Stop ( ) : void
TransfarLimitManager ( AmoebaManager amoebaManager ) : System

Protected Methods

Method Description
Dispose ( bool disposing ) : void
OnStartEvent ( ) : void
OnStopEvent ( ) : void

Private Methods

Method Description
WatchThread ( ) : void

Method Details

Dispose() protected method

protected Dispose ( bool disposing ) : void
disposing bool
return void

Load() public method

public Load ( string directoryPath ) : void
directoryPath string
return void

OnStartEvent() protected method

protected OnStartEvent ( ) : void
return void

OnStopEvent() protected method

protected OnStopEvent ( ) : void
return void

Reset() public method

public Reset ( ) : void
return void

Save() public method

public Save ( string directoryPath ) : void
directoryPath string
return void

Start() public method

public Start ( ) : void
return void

Stop() public method

public Stop ( ) : void
return void

TransfarLimitManager() public method

public TransfarLimitManager ( AmoebaManager amoebaManager ) : System
amoebaManager Library.Net.Amoeba.AmoebaManager
return System

Property Details

_startEvent public_oe property

public EventHandler _startEvent
return EventHandler

_stopEvent public_oe property

public EventHandler _stopEvent
return EventHandler